mployees’ performance is a critical element of the overall organizational performance
in high performing companies, so its management is vital. Globalised economies have
increased competition for organizations, so managers are under enormous pressure to
improve performance and remain ahead of competitors. This paper looks at factors that
improve the likelihood of organizations attaining peak performance. The paper examines the
mediation effect of employee engagement on the relationship between employer
obligations, employee obligations and state of the psychological contract and; employee
performance. Due to different conceptualization of the psychological contract concept, this
paper examines the concept from employer obligations, employee obligations and state of
the psychological contract. The paper concludes that employee engagement assumes a
critical precursor role to employee performance at the workplace
